The FTG Salvos is huge. It is the biggest op shop I have ever been to and the range is quite impressive. They tend to stock a lot of brand name clothes, probably because they are so close to Knox City Shopping Centre and most of the donations are sourced locally. The prices can get pretty high here so I don’t rate them too highly for their service as a charity shop. While I commend the Salvos for their work, it kind of defeats the point if they raise prices so much that the people they exist to help cannot afford to shop there anymore. The newer the item is here, the more expensive. While this can be a frustration for the needy this is super good for vintage hunters like myself. I have picked up three or so very cute vintage dresses in great condition for around $ 6 each here. Similar dresses on ebay sell for upwards of $ 40 so I’m pretty chuffed with my finds. As usual, the staff here are friendly and chatty so allow time for a cash register convo. The store sells bric-à-brac, books, shoes, magazines, furniture, formal attire and regular clothing wear. Donation bins are out the front.
